Christopher Kelly, owner of Cernunnos Farms: Pushing the boundaries of traditional craftsmanship

After more than thirty years working at the intersection of creativity and technical ingenuity in the entertainment industry, Chris chose to venture into entrepreneurship. He channelled all of that experience toward a pursuit that was both unexpected and deeply rooted in his background, the artisanal crafting of beeswax candles. Today, Cernunnos Farms ships its handcrafted creations across Canada and internationally, and Chris credits part of that success to the support of Microcredit Montréal.

His entrepreneurial journey didn’t begin with candles. While pursuing an agritourism project, a lavender farm outside Ottawa where beeswax candles would serve as a complementary product alongside lavender and honey, Chris discovered something unexpected. The candles were taking on a life of their own, and their growing popularity made the path forward clear. He pivoted to make them the heart of his business.

An entrepreneurial path beyond the original vision

What began at a small farmers’ market in Vankleek Hill, Ontario, gradually grew. Customers kept coming back, requests for new points of sale multiplied, and the side project slowly became the main business.

“As is often the case, you start with a plan and end up somewhere else. Part of the beauty of entrepreneurship is recognising that you haven’t gone off course — the train is moving powerfully in a direction, and you need to be able to adapt and follow that momentum,” he explains.

Growing a Montréal business through innovative practices

Building Cernunnos Farms required an uncommon range of skills from Chris. Each candle begins as a 3D-printed prototype, which he then transforms into a mould, allowing him to explore unconventional shapes. He also developed his own natural dyeing process and built much of his production equipment himself when commercial solutions were out of reach. This combination of creativity and mechanical skill has allowed him to develop candles that truly stand out in a crowded market. He was also recently accepted as the only candle maker within the Conseil des métiers d’art du Québec, a recognition that speaks to the originality of his work.

Financing a micro-enterprise with microcredit

When Chris began looking for financing, he quickly ran into a familiar obstacle for start-up entrepreneurs. Traditional small business loans were largely out of reach, as his business fell into a category that conventional financing simply doesn’t serve. That’s when he discovered Microcredit Montréal.

“I realised I wasn’t a small business — I was a micro-enterprise. And I thought, what I need is microcredit.”

He received a $5,000 three-year loan from Microcredit Montréal, which allowed him to build a solid foundation for thoughtful growth. Beyond the initial financing, his adviser also supported him through the process of becoming a recognised artisan with the Conseil des métiers d’art du Québec. “That first $5,000 really gave me the momentum I needed to gain greater recognition for the business.” Chris also received financial support from the Canadian organisation Rise, whose mission is to help people facing mental health and addiction challenges become entrepreneurs.

Today, Cernunnos Farms is present at Montréal’s major artisan markets and ships its products to customers across North America, as well as to Australia, Germany, and the Netherlands, all through entirely organic growth, with no formal advertising.

When asked about it, Chris is optimistic about the future. As the business continues to grow with new products and markets on the horizon, his long-term ambitions go well beyond that. Through his company, he sees a real opportunity to introduce beeswax candles to a broader audience across the country, to the benefit of the environment and the Québec economy.

“The goal of Cernunnos Farms is to democratise the use of beeswax candles and bring them to the general public.”
